PROTECTOR LAMP-THE HOME OF THE MINERS LAMP SINCE 1873
Protector Lamp have been making flame safety lamps in Eccles since 1873, the GR6S Garforth lamp or deputies lamp is the recognised means of testing for firedamp/ methane in all UK coal mines, it is approved to Atex M2 Mining. We also distribute and sell led head torches and cap lamps for mining,industry and firefighters including the KSE Lights range,led lamp,mining lamp.
